Job Title: SC System and Master Data Manager, Oncology

Location: Lexington, MA

About the role:

The position will cover all SC systems and master data topics related to Oncology products globally, mainly working with US (Lexington, Cambridge) and EU (Singen and Linz) based team

  • Key user of Takeda using SAP systems (ECC, APO, AIP, OEP, IBP) including SAST Requestor/Approver
  • SAP/MDG coordinator, key user and Data Steward role
  • Ariba SCC key user including onboarding support for new vendors
  • Training of employees, new on boarders and apprentices
  • Create, update and maintain related procedures and step-guides
  • Global/Regional Digital and IT improvement project lead
  • Project manager for supply chain related system implementation & improvement
  • Lead the coordination to solve complex system issues

How you will contribute:

  • Point of contact for trouble shooting activities related to systems managed in the key user scope (ECC, MDG, Ariba SCC etc.)
  • Create & update the training documentation, procedures and step-guides
  • Conduct Onboarding and training of employees, new on boarders, apprentices and student workers
  • Create training evidence certificates for SAP role requests
  • Create SAST requests for Users
  • Lead & Participate UAT testing for system implementation & maintenance
  • Facilitate business and project team for system implementations
  • Support internal stakeholders & new vendors for the Ariba SCC onboarding, including training and testing
  • Lead MDG implementation in the region, including knowledge transfer & best-practice sharing
  • Material Master MDG Data Steward role for Oncology Products
  • Lead Global/Regional Digital IT improvement project
  • Project manager for supply chain related system implementations
  • Key user for IBP S&OP and Supply Planning module
